Output ae577adef76bb661afdeae8807ab3b72bad4ac5c5738c137b678c94434e61bfa:3

value
72886
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e9952c2afbff2929bcbfe820031689bec2965e65f4c54e91d96e3d8baf79c511
address
tb1pax2jc2hmlu5jn09laqsqx95fhmpfvhn97nz5aywedc7chtmec5gsmmzfhc
transaction
ae577adef76bb661afdeae8807ab3b72bad4ac5c5738c137b678c94434e61bfa
confirmations
65491
spent
true